thats so dumb.. theres a line you just shouldnt cross then it just becomes retarded.. that ride has to be the most shittiest ride ever.. and i couldnt even imagine how brutal it would be in a cobalt.. but you would need probably bags.. a super low offset wheel.. a lot of camber adjustment and roll your fender like ****** crazy.. then you will also need a couple weeks off work for physical therapy on your back.

The thought crossed my mind to do a low offset/stretch/slam build for the Slowbalt.......I was considering some custom black/polished 18" CCW's.....super wide, a nice stagger and some retarded low offsets with a mild stretch.......plus some Stance GR+ coilovers.....but I just can't bring myself to spend anymore money on a car I no longer love
And thus, the mad scientist RX-8 plan was put into play.
Here is a photoshop that AreTee (owner of Stance:Nation) put together for me....pretty much exactly how I want the car to look. The plan is Stance GR+ coilovers w/ removed collars + 18"x9.5" Work Emotion XC-8's +12 all around, and stretching the factory 225/40/18 tires.

And I want to pay homage to one of the original cars that made me fall so deeply in love with the stance/hellaflush scene. I remember seeing this car online about a year ago. After seeing this it was all over and I decided it was time to put the Cobalt up for sale and embark on a new journey. (yes, the Cobalt is still for sale......FML
